Job Title: Project Manager

Summary/Objective:

GeoPoint Surveying, Inc. is a land surveying firm with multiple locations, specializing in land development, remote sensing, energy, geospatial mapping, commercial surveys, and subsurface utility engineering.

The Project Manager performs Boundary Surveys, ALTA/NSPS Land Title Surveys, Topographic Surveys, prepare Subdivision Plats, prepare Legal Descriptions, Construction Staking & As-Built surveys, and various other types of surveys. Also performs public record research and calculations to resolve property boundaries and rights of way; will review survey technician’s work and serve as project manager on various sized survey projects. You will assist in crew scheduling for multiple crews and help prepare crews for their field work. You will assist and/or prepare construction staking calculations and reports as needed. You may be required to work in the field on occasion and make sure equipment is maintained, repaired, and calibrated as needed.

Essential Job Functions:

  • Responsible for survey calculations, analysis and final map checking, abstracting title data, record drawings research, and client relations
  • Coordination with clients, crews, and technicians to establish project responsibilities and priorities
  • Coordination with the other discipline leads on scheduling objectives and project milestones
  • Assignment of daily responsibilities for survey field crews and office technicians
  • Perform boundary analysis for large-scale sectionalized land surveys
  • Sign and seal surveys, maps, and survey related documents
  • Perform in-process quality control of survey field activities, calculations, and preliminary project deliverables

Qualifications:

  • Licensed as a Professional Surveyor and Mapper in the State of office location or ability to obtain license within 12 months
  • 2 years of post-registration experience with 4 years progressive survey experience
  • Four-year degree in Geomatics or related field highly preferred
  • Strong technical skills, including experience with AutoCAD Civil3D
  • Experience with aerial or mobile LiDAR platforms and software highly preferred
  • Strong organizational skills and experience with Microsoft Office
  • Demonstrated experience in project/phase management for large-scale private sector survey projects
  • Ability to solve complex problems using sound professional judgment, creativity, and innovation
